Abstract

A method of determining an equivalent output value for a failed sensor in a vehicle seat having an occupancy sensing system. The method includes the steps of sensing the output of each sensor in an array of sensors that detect a physical presence in the seat. If the output of the sensor falls below a predetermined value, exceeds a predetermined value, or remains fixed the sensor is classified as inoperative. The method then calculates an equivalent sensor output value for any sensor classified as inoperative and applies the sensor array output values for each operable sensor in the array and the calculated equivalent output value for any inoperative sensor to a neural net. Then, the applied sensor output values are recognizing as falling within one of a group of predetermined classification patterns that represent a physical presence in the seat defined by size, weight, and physical orientation.
